Cabinet Material Types
Choosing the right cabinet material plays a crucial role in the durability and functionality of your kitchen. Plywood is a strong choice, resisting warping and supporting heavy loads. It’s perfect for busy kitchens.
MDF offers a smooth surface that’s great for detailed finishes, though it’s less moisture-resistant than plywood. Particle board is the most budget-friendly option but tends to be less durable and vulnerable to water damage.
If you want lighter cabinets that are easier to install, engineered wood options like MDF and particle board fit the bill. Just keep in mind you’ll need to handle them carefully to avoid damage. Understanding these material differences helps you pick cabinets that match your kitchen’s demands and your lifestyle perfectly.
Storage Capacity Needs
Since kitchen storage needs vary widely, you’ll want to assess your available space carefully to determine the right cabinet dimensions and layout. Measure width, height, and depth to guarantee cabinets fit comfortably and maximize storage.
Look for cabinets with multiple compartments and adjustable shelves to make the most of vertical and horizontal space. That way, you can store everything from large cookware to small utensils efficiently. Don’t forget to check the weight capacity of shelves and drawers to handle heavy appliances safely.
Consider the total cubic volume for bulk storage needs, and identify special features like deep drawers or dedicated compartments that boost organization and accessibility. Thoughtful evaluation of these factors will help you choose cabinets that truly meet your kitchen’s storage demands.

Durability and Finish
Once your cabinets are set up, their durability and finish determine how well they’ll hold up over time. Choose plywood or engineered wood over particle board for stronger resistance against daily wear. A waterproof or UV finish adds a protective layer, shielding surfaces from moisture and scratches.
Opt for cabinets with high-quality hardware like soft-close glides and hinges to boost durability. Environmentally friendly paint finishes not only promote better indoor air quality but also guard against stains and damage. To keep your cabinets looking fresh and lasting longer, clean them regularly with suitable products.

How Do I Clean and Maintain Big Box Kitchen Cabinets?
To clean and maintain your kitchen cabinets, wipe them regularly with a soft cloth and mild soap mixed with warm water.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age the finish. For stubborn stains, use a gentle cleaner designed for wood or laminate.
Make sure to dry the surfaces thoroughly to prevent moisture damage. Tighten screws and hinges occasionally to keep doors aligned. By staying consistent, you’ll keep your cabinets looking fresh and functioning well for years.
Are Big Box Kitchen Cabinets Eco-Friendly?
Eco-friendly? Sometimes, yes. You’ll find some big box kitchen cabinets made from sustainable materials or recycled wood. But don’t put all your eggs in one basket.
Many still use particleboard with formaldehyde and non-renewable resources. To make sure you’re green, check product labels for certifications like FSC or CARB compliance.
With a little digging, you can find cabinets that treat the earth kindly while fitting your budget. It just takes a bit of looking around!

What Warranty Do Big Box Kitchen Cabinets Typically Offer?
Big box kitchen cabinets typically come with warranties ranging from 1 to 5 years, covering defects in materials and workmanship. Some brands offer limited lifetime warranties on cabinet boxes or hardware, but it varies widely. You should check the specific warranty details before purchasing, as coverage for finishes, hinges, and drawer slides may differ.
